Add, remove and track subscription members

If you have a Team or Enterprise subscription, owners and managers of your account can add, remove and track current members of the subscription

Access the Members tab:

  • Click on your profile in the top right corner to select "Admin settings"
  • Click on “Members” on the left side menu.

Add Members: 

  • Click “invite members” in the top right corner.
  • Write or copy-paste multiple emails into the invitation field
  • or import a CVS file with emails of the people you want to add as members. More info here

  • Instruct your users to sign up to Doodle if they haven't already. There are several different ways for users to log into their Doodle accounts:
    • SSO (Enterprise only) - Single Sign On (SSO) allows end users to log into Doodle (and any other application with SSO configured) via a single set of credentials. SSO provides IT teams with greater control over which users may access Doodle. You can set up SSO under the admin tab “Apps and Integrations”.

    • Social Logins - Social Logins allow users to log in via their Google, Microsoft, or Facebook credentials. If your organization leverages Office 365 (Outlook) or Gmail, we recommend having your users log in via the “Continue with Google” or “Continue with Microsoft” buttons. This way, if a user leaves your company and their email is deprovisioned, they will no longer have access to your corporate Doodle account.

    • Email & password - This is a traditional login method that requires users to remember their password or store it in a password management system. 

Re-send invitation to Pending Members

Under "Pending" you can find the members that you have invited but who have not yet accepted the invitation. 

  • Click on "Pending"
  • Click on three vertical dots next to the member 
  • Select "re-send invitation"
  • If necessary, share this link with your new members to help them become active members.

Remove Members: 

  • Use the search field to locate the member you want to remove.
  • Click on the three vertical dots next to the member
  • Select “Remove”.

This will not delete the Doodle account of the member, but it will remove their access to the Doodle subscription.

Track Members:

Under the “Members” tab, you can track the status of your membership invitations.

  • Click “Active” to see the users who have accepted the invitation to the subscription.
  • Click "Pending" to see the users who have not yet answered the invitation to the subscription. 
  • Click "All" to see all the users (both active and pending) of the subscription.

Assign a member an admin role: 

You can grant a member of your subscription various admin roles.

  • Click on “active” to see all your active members.
  • Click on the three vertical dots next to the name of the member
  • Select "change role".

The member will receive an email informing them of their new role.

Admins of a Team subscription will have access to “Member” and “Owner” roles. Admins of Enterprise subscription will in addition have access to “Group Admin” and “Manager” roles.
